Publisher Description

What ties us to those who came before us?

In stark, stunningly beautiful language, the narrator Alma tells the story of her family over a century, starting in a small village in northern Germany at the end of the German empire, and moving through the first and second world wars and up to present-day Vienna.

Interlaced with surreal, magical details - a boy who is born asleep and doesn't wake up until he's a young man, an undertaker's lemon tree that bears fruit all year, and a midwife who never seems to age - the novel describes lives shaped by the rhythms and patterns of the earth and the rich, complex emotional inheritance that generations visit on one another.

Rich in restrained emotion - and as deeply moving as it is brutally unsentimental - as full of wonder as it is horror, this is an unforgettable debut novel.
